正方数字化校园建设方案-w - 图文(3)

2019-08-30 23:48

广州大学松田学院数字化校园建设方案

3、应用系统层:是面向学校各部处的各类信息管理系统和面向师生的各类信息服务系统,可以分为管理中心、资源中心、服务中心,具体如下:

? 管理中心包括学校现有应用系统和新建应用系统;

? 资源中心是指整个学校的各类资源库、资源库的管理、资源服务。资源库包括教

学资源、数字教学资源、数字图书馆、数字档案馆、各类数字出版产品及数字期刊等数字资源;

? 服务中心是指提供的各类信息服务和人工服务,包括管理中心、资源中心提供的

信息服务,认证服务,邮件、短信、即时消息等通讯服务,一卡通服务,软硬件运维服务等。

4、信息服务层:为各级领导、相关管理员、教师、学生提供各种个人业务操作服务、查询、报表、统计分析、决策等,还可以根据系统数据得到数据填报、提醒、报警等一站式信息服务。

5、信息安全体系:数字化校园的安全管理,包括安全策略、安全组织、安全评估、安全技术等。

6、信息标准/管理/保障体系:包括信息、技术标准、组织机构、管理制度、运维保障体系等。

2.3.2 基于SOA的数字化校园架构设计

基于SOA的数字化校园架构设计的核心是建立学校SOA架构的技术标准,学校的不同厂家、不同产品、不同运行环境、不同开发工具开发的应用系统信息系统遵循该技术标准,进行组件化和服务化,实现了松散型、低耦合的集成,不同的信息系统可以相互调用功能服务。这样就大大提高了学校软件的重复使用率,提高软件系统的可扩展性,减低了学校的IT资源投资和IT建设风险。

广州大学松田学院基于SOA的架构设计如下图所示:

第 11 页 共 86 页

广州大学松田学院数字化校园建设方案

行政人员服务学生服务教师服务领导服务校友服务信息服务层应用服务层服务管理平台服务集成服务注册服务管理服务发布教务管理系统教学质量评估系统学生工作管理系统迎新服务系统电子离校服务系统科研管理系统学生收费管理系统教材管理系统数字资源管理系统资产设备管理系统办公自动化系统人力资源管理系统继续教育管理系统网上学习系统实验室管理系统校友服务系统 业务组件服务组织机构服务、可复用的业务功能服务、其他服务 公共组件服务用户与授权、身份认证与SSO、日志服务、数据服务、数据交换服务、工作流服务、报表服务、表单服务、消息服务、查询统计服务基础服务层服务库元数据数据标准教务|资产|科研|研究生|人事|财务|办公?数据中心库教务数据 科研数据??教务公共数据科研公共数据??公共数据库数据交换中心业务系统数据层 数字资源库教学资源、学术资源、数字图书馆、数字档案、??ESB、BPM、SOA标准(SCA\\SDO)、XML、Webservices、WSDL、SOAP、UDDI、JMS系统软件:Unix/Linux、Oracle、Ldap、AS、Portal Server二次开发平台基设施础网络硬件广州大学松田学院基于SOA的架构采取的技术路线: 1、基于SOA技术的系统架构

SOA架构的技术标准主要有:服务组件架构SCA与服务数据对象 SDO。基于开放标准采用的相关技术有:

? 可扩展标记语言XML(Extensible Markup Language) ? 简单对象访问协议SOAP (Simple Object Access Protocol) ? Web服务描述语言 WSDL (Web Services Description Language)

? 统一描述、发现和集成 (Universal Description, Discovery and Integration) ? JAVA消息服务JMS ( Java Message Service) ? 企业服务总线ESB(Enterprise Service Bus)

第 12 页 共 86 页

广州大学松田学院数字化校园建设方案

服务管理平台SMP数据库数据库类基础应用J2EE服务.Net服务服务集成服务重组工具支持开发基础服务库服务注册服务路由服务发布服务转换监控配置部署其他基础服务中间件应用服务器

通过服务管理平台SMP来实现服务的集成、注册、发布、管理。

SOA服务主要是指Web服务,但SOA的发展与实现需要一个过程,所以目前需要对服务的范围进行扩展,而不仅仅指Web服务。

SOA服务包括:

1、Web Service,通WEB服务提供的主要是数据类服务,如学生基本信息、成绩信息等,统一身份认证的身份数据服务等;

2、URL资源功能服务,基于身份认证的基础上的,以URL调用方式提供的功能服务; 3、WEB剪辑,支持从应用服务器可以访问到的页面进行区域裁剪,裁剪后的内容作为提供的服务进行统一管理;

4、Iframe集成服务,支持嵌入其他系统的页面,用于实现和其他网站界面的无缝集成,并可以控制集成后服务的形式;

5、RSS集成服务,支持自动从其他符合RSS规范的网站或门户采集到需要的数据,并定义相应的服务方式;

6、API集成服务,适合于具有基于技术标准与规范的API接口的应用系统功能服务集成;

7、Portlets集成服务,集成基于Portal规范的Portlets提供的服务。 提供各种服务集成的组件,如下图所示:

第 13 页 共 86 页

广州大学松田学院数字化校园建设方案

2、开发平台

本次应用系统基于J2EE平台,主体代码采用Java编程语言和服务器端Java技术(如EJBs、Servlet、JSP、JNDI、JDBC和RMI等13种)开发。

J2EE平台是目前为企业级应用所提供的分布式、高可靠性、先进性的解决方案。Java作为基于Web的软件业的公共标准,其独立于操作系统,独立于服务器的“跨平台性”,使其“一次编写,到处运行”,是最适合运行于互联网上软件的编辑语言。Java相对于嵌入HTML并受限于用户端显示的编程能力有限的脚本语言,其完整的编程能力可开发具有强大“业务逻辑”的应用程序。

我们使用Java相关技术配合先进的开发和管理工具完整地执行于整个软件开发生命周期中。如下图所示:

第 14 页 共 86 页

广州大学松田学院数字化校园建设方案

采用分布式组件EJB和Web Services实现业务逻辑;服务的定位采用JNDI/UDDI方式,支持分布式服务提供者。

基础框架J2EEHTTPS表现层ServletJSPXSLTStruts认证授权SSORBACAdapterLDAP门户XSLTAJAxRSSPortletWSRPXML数据中心元数据业务逻辑层EJBWebServicesJMSJAAS数据交换数据映射数据持久层iBatisJDOHibernateJDBC安全技术JAASMD5OracleSSL

采用面向对象的组件技术:

面向对象的组件技术是一种完全独立于硬件和操作系统的开发环境,着重于开发构成应用程序“业务对象”的可重复使用的组件,利用这些组件顺利地建立分布式应用程序。

应用程序的开发和运行结构:

应用系统平台的开发及运行结构要基于后台数据库的三层架构,即Web服务器、应用

第 15 页 共 86 页


正方数字化校园建设方案-w - 图文(3).doc 将本文的Word文档下载到电脑 下载失败或者文档不完整,请联系客服人员解决!

下一篇:2015-2016学年高一语文导学案:第1单元+第3课《大堰河-我的保姆

相关阅读
本类排行
× 注册会员免费下载(下载后可以自由复制和排版)

马上注册会员

注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信: QQ: